Woodbury County Attorney James Loomis filed a trial information charging Thomas Popp with first-degree murder for the shooting death of Terri McCauley.
As of Saturday, March 8, 62-year-old Thomas Popp was booked into the Woodbury County Jail on a $3 million bond for the murder of 18-year-old Terri McCauley more than 40 years ago.
